Eye diseases such as cataracts, glaucoma, and severe myopia can drastically impair vision. In many cases, surgery is the only solution to prevent complete blindness. Unfortunately, these surgeries can be high-priced, and not everyone can afford them. When health coverage is lacking, patients and their families must turn to alternative ways to raise funds.
Urgent medical need: Conditions like cataracts can develop fast, making prompt treatment vital.
Monetary challenges: High costs of medical procedures and recovery can be overwhelming.
Psychological effect: Losing vision impairs daily functioning and emotional well-being.

Create a compelling personal story
Telling the story of the patient’s challenges and dreams inspires generosity. Genuine emotion and sincerity matter.
Use online platforms for charity campaigns
Websites like GoFundMe?, JustGiving?, or dedicated charity sites (e.g., helpmyeyes.com) allow easy donation collection and sharing.
Engage social media
Using social media helps reach a wider audience. Encourage sharing with hashtags like #HelpSaveVision? or #EyeSurgeryFund?.
Contact neighborhood clubs and institutions
Local organizations can organize events or contribute financially.
Host charity activities
Charity runs, auctions, bake sales, or concerts can raise funds and awareness simultaneously.
Maintain openness and regular communication
Regularly inform donors about the fundraising progress, surgery dates, and recovery. This builds trust and encourages continued support.
